Sleep Apnea Risk After 35: Why Perimenopause Changes the Picture for Women

Sleep apnea is often discussed as a condition primarily affecting men, but research increasingly shows that the picture shifts for women as they move through perimenopause. Understanding why this happens can help women recognize symptoms that might otherwise be dismissed as ordinary sleep changes associated with getting older.

Obstructive sleep apnea (OSA) involves repeated pauses in breathing during sleep, typically caused by relaxation of throat muscles that partially or fully blocks the airway. According to the American Sleep Association, OSA prevalence in women rises notably after menopause, narrowing what was previously a substantial gender gap in diagnosis rates observed in younger adults. This shift is significant from a public health standpoint because OSA in women has historically been underdiagnosed relative to men, partly due to differences in symptom presentation and partly due to diagnostic criteria and screening tools that were originally developed and validated primarily in male populations.

What Research Shows About Hormones and Airway Function

Estrogen and progesterone are believed to play a protective role in maintaining upper airway muscle tone and respiratory drive during sleep, which may help explain why premenopausal women have historically shown lower rates of OSA compared to men of similar age. As estrogen and progesterone levels decline during perimenopause and menopause, this protective effect appears to diminish, which researchers believe contributes to rising OSA rates in this population. Weight changes that sometimes accompany this life stage may also play a contributing role, independent of hormonal shifts.

Symptoms That Are Often Overlooked

Sleep apnea symptoms in women can look somewhat different from the classic presentation often associated with men, which may include loud snoring witnessed by a partner. Women with OSA more frequently report symptoms like persistent fatigue, morning headaches, difficulty concentrating, mood changes, or insomnia, symptoms that overlap considerably with those attributed to perimenopause more broadly. This overlap is part of why OSA can go undiagnosed in women — symptoms are sometimes assumed to be “just” hormonal changes rather than investigated as a distinct, treatable sleep disorder.

Distinguishing OSA From General Perimenopausal Sleep Changes

While many sleep disruptions during perimenopause relate to hot flashes or night sweats, OSA involves actual pauses in breathing that can be identified through a sleep study. If a partner has noticed gasping, choking sounds, or breathing pauses during sleep, or if fatigue persists despite what seems like adequate sleep duration, this is worth raising specifically with a healthcare provider, since it points toward a different underlying mechanism than hormonal hot flashes alone.

How Sleep Apnea Is Diagnosed

Diagnosis typically involves a sleep study, either conducted in a sleep lab or, increasingly, through validated at-home testing devices, depending on individual circumstances and symptom severity. The study measures breathing patterns, oxygen levels, and other markers during sleep to determine whether pauses in breathing are occurring and how frequently. A primary care provider or sleep specialist can help determine whether a sleep study is appropriate based on reported symptoms and risk factors.

Why Identifying OSA Matters

Untreated sleep apnea has been associated in research with a range of longer-term health considerations, including cardiovascular strain, so identifying and addressing it isn’t just about improving sleep quality in the moment. Treatment options, including CPAP therapy and other approaches, are well established and can significantly improve both sleep quality and associated symptoms for many patients, though the right approach depends on individual severity and preferences, best discussed with a sleep specialist.

Sleep Apnea During Pregnancy vs. Perimenopause

It’s worth distinguishing perimenopausal OSA from sleep apnea that can also emerge during pregnancy, since both are relevant to women navigating fertility and midlife health after 35. Pregnancy-related OSA has been studied in connection with weight gain, hormonal changes, and swelling in the upper airway, and research has explored possible associations between untreated pregnancy-related OSA and outcomes like gestational hypertension, though this remains an active area of study. Some clinics now include screening questions about snoring and sleep quality as part of routine prenatal care, particularly for women with other risk factors.

For women managing both a pregnancy after 35 and questions about sleep quality, it can be worth mentioning any snoring, gasping, or witnessed breathing pauses to a prenatal provider directly, since this symptom set is sometimes overlooked amid the many other topics covered during prenatal visits. Addressing OSA during pregnancy, when identified, generally follows similar treatment approaches to OSA at other life stages, adapted as needed for pregnancy-specific considerations.

Long-Term Monitoring Across Life Stages

Because OSA risk can shift across different life stages — potentially emerging during pregnancy, resolving postpartum, and then re-emerging during perimenopause years later — some sleep specialists suggest that women with any history of pregnancy-related sleep apnea keep this in mind as a personal risk factor worth mentioning if sleep symptoms resurface later in life, rather than assuming it’s an isolated, one-time issue.

Practical Signs Worth Tracking

Because self-reported snoring can be unreliable — many people are unaware of their own nighttime breathing patterns — involving a partner’s observations, or using a smartphone app or wearable device that tracks sound and movement during sleep, can help build a clearer picture before a formal evaluation. These tools are not diagnostic on their own, but they can provide useful information to bring to a healthcare provider when deciding whether a full sleep study is warranted.
